Quantity measurements fluctuate drastically dependant upon how the flour was scooped in to the cup. There is often approximately a 25% increase in the event you specifically scooped the flour within the bag. I extremely propose using weight measurements for baking recipes, as observed inside the recipe for consistent effects. Or to be expecting variations if using volume measurements.

A flour scald in bread will take benefit of this phenomenon in two ways. A single, simply because a gelled combination of flour and water is drier in texture than A similar ungelled a person, it means that you can create a dough with much more h2o in it than it could in any other case comprise—with out it turning to soup.
